Abstract

Meatballs are one of the foods that are popular with various groups in Indonesia. Borax is a prohibited substance used as a food additive. Borax is commonly used in soldering, glassmaking, porcelain and wood preservatives. The use of borax in crackers aims to increase the elasticity of the meatballs. The purpose of this study was to detect the presence of borax in meatball samples.This type of research is descriptive, the method used is a qualitative method. Meatball samples were taken from meatball traders who sold them in the Karang Jangu area, Meatball samples were taken from meatball traders who sold them in the Karang Jangu area and examined using tumeric paper, tumeric paper (curcumin paper) is filter paper that is dipped in turmeric solution and dried, after that the sample that has been diluted and homogenized is dripped onto the tumeric paper. Based on the results of the study of the five meatball samples that were examined qualitatively using tumeric paper, negative results were obtained or did not contain borax, this was made clear by the absence of a color change on the tumeric paper. It is hoped that future researchers can use other methods. which can detect the presence and levels of borax in meatballs.
